Pipe Bag, c. 1870. America, Native North American, Plains, Tsitsistas (Cheyenne) people, Post-Contact. Native-tanned hide with yellow pigment, glass beads, red trade cloth, tin cones, sinew thread; overall: 71.1 x 12.7 cm (28 x 5 in.).
